One of the biggest questions that brand new owners of memory foam mattress have is, “Why do I need a support in the first place? Can’t I just put the mattress on the floor?” In all actuality, it is perfectly acceptable to put your memory foam mattress directly on the floor without any type of support at all. Your mattress will perform better the firmer and more uniform its foundation, and you can’t get any better than a solid floor.




However, this can also pose some unique problems. For one, placing a mattress directly on the floor keeps it very low to the ground, which could make getting in and out of bed quite difficult. What’s more, your comforter or duvet is likely to drag the ground in this scenario, which does little to keep it clean. Before you decide to save yourself some money and put your new memory foam mattress on the floor, check with the manufacturer. In some cases, using a mattress without the proper foundation can void the warranty. A wood slat memory foam mattress foundation is exactly what it sounds like – a platform constructed of wooden slats. However, it is important to realize that not all of these foundations are created equally. If the slats are too far apart, the foam can sag through the openings and diminish the integrity of the foam.




If your existing platform has slats that have gaps of three inches or more, you will need to add some pressboard or plywood for support. A metal memory foam mattress foundation can provide you with all of the same support as its wooden counterparts, but you have to be careful to choose a product made of strong metal. Otherwise, your weight over time could cause the legs or other support surfaces to bend, which impacts not only your comfort, but also the overall longevity of your mattress. Adjustable bases are increasing in popularity these days, particularly among couples who deal with snoring or individuals with health issues. There are several adjustable foundation manufacturers out there today, and each one offers up a number of products designed to provide you with a customizable sleeping surface.




Remember, though: not all memory foam mattresses are designed to be used with an adjustable foundation, so once again, make sure you check with the manufacturer of your mattress before you go this route.
